Chapter 2: The Great Robo-Donut Run

480 Words
The StellarGlide 5000, with its unusual cargo of robots, zipped through the neon-drenched streets of Neo-Kyoto. Unit 734, despite his earlier reservations, found himself enjoying the sensation of speed. The StellarGlide 5000 handled beautifully, its rocket boosters providing a satisfying thrust. "Faster! Faster!" Sparky squealed from the back, his exposed wires sparking with excitement. "Steady, Sparky," Bolt-Head cautioned, his bolt head wobbling precariously. "We don't want to attract the Robo-Police." Zorgon, leaning back in the passenger seat, seemed more interested in the scenery. "Neo-Kyoto," he rumbled, "a city of dreams…and delicious robo-donuts." Flicker, still twitching nervously, kept glancing at the chrono-meter. "The Robo-Donut Emporium closes in t-minus five cycles! We must hurry!" Unit 734, ever the efficient bot, calculated the optimal route to the donut shop, taking into account traffic patterns and the StellarGlide's top speed. He expertly weaved through the traffic, his chrome chassis gleaming under the neon lights. As they approached the Robo-Donut Emporium, they could see the lights flickering and the "CLOSED" sign being flipped in the window. "We're too late!" Flicker cried, his voice laced with despair. Zorgon slammed his fist on the dashboard. "No! Not the robo-donuts! They're my weakness!" Unit 734, however, had a plan. He engaged the StellarGlide's emergency boosters, the car leaping forward with a sudden burst of speed. They screeched to a halt in front of the Emporium just as the robo-clerk was locking the door. "Hold it right there!" Unit 734 announced, his synthesized voice echoing through the street. The robo-clerk, a small, boxy bot with a name tag that read "Gears," turned around, startled. "Sorry, we're closed," Gears chirped. "Come back tomorrow." Zorgon, Bolt-Head, and Sparky piled out of the StellarGlide 5000, their expressions pleading. "Please, Gears!" Zorgon begged. "Just a dozen robo-donuts! We'll pay double!" "We've come all the way from Sector Gamma!" Bolt-Head added, his bolt head bobbing desperately. Sparky, unable to contain his excitement, zipped around Gears, his wires sparking. "They're so delicious! Especially the chocolate-covered ones with extra sprinkles!" Gears hesitated, then glanced at Unit 734. "Is this…your crew?" Unit 734 nodded. "Affirmative. They are…enthusiastic about robo-donuts." Gears sighed. "Alright, alright. But just a quick order. I'm already late for my recharging cycle." The five robots cheered, and a flurry of donut orders filled the air. Zorgon ordered a dozen glazed, Bolt-Head opted for the nut-and-bolt flavored ones, Sparky requested extra sprinkles, and Flicker, still nervous, just wanted a plain robo-bun. Unit 734, after analyzing the nutritional information, decided on a low-calorie fuel cell bar. With their precious cargo of robo-donuts secured, they piled back into the StellarGlide 5000. As Unit 734 pulled away from the Robo-Donut Emporium, he couldn't help but feel a strange sense of…satisfaction. He had helped these robots achieve their mission. And, he had to admit, the aroma of robo-donuts was rather…pleasant. Perhaps, he thought, he might even try one himself…tomorrow.
